English Language Arts
- The child practiced alphabetizing words by arranging the Pokemon cards within each type in alphabetical order.
- They identified the types of the Pokemon cards, such as Grass, Fire, Water, Electric, etc.
- The child learned to use descriptive words to identify and categorize different Pokemon cards.
- They practiced reading and understanding the names of the Pokemon cards.
Math
- The child used their counting skills to keep track of the number of Pokemon cards in each type.
- They learned to organize and group the Pokemon cards according to their type.
- The child practiced using logical thinking skills to make decisions on where to place each card within its corresponding type.
- They practiced comparing and categorizing the Pokemon cards based on their types.
To further develop the child's skills related to sorting and categorizing, you can encourage them to create their own Pokemon cards or use other sets of cards or objects to sort and categorize. Additionally, you can introduce more complex sorting criteria such as sorting by multiple attributes or creating a hierarchy within each type.
